Output 36489520e3f58182581b0a3fe5458843b3c87318604c38c726c726c95573e030:15

value
1541070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da19e841cf4074fb69fbbe7f9c7f5392eee85d50 OP_EQUAL
address
3MaEGRuza964qpPbEJmzJhyop7dQZPr2nT
transaction
36489520e3f58182581b0a3fe5458843b3c87318604c38c726c726c95573e030
spent
true